Gustavo A. R. Silva 94f2026bd8 drm/amdgpu/smu10: Replace one-element array and use struct_size() helper
The current codebase makes use of one-element arrays in the following
form:

struct something {
    int length;
    u8 data[1];
};

struct something *instance;

instance = kmalloc(sizeof(*instance) + size, GFP_KERNEL);
instance->length = size;
memcpy(instance->data, source, size);

but the preferred mechanism to declare variable-length types such as
these ones is a flexible array member[1][2], introduced in C99:

struct foo {
        int stuff;
        struct boo array[];
};

By making use of the mechanism above, we will get a compiler warning
in case the flexible array does not occur last in the structure, which
will help us prevent some kind of undefined behavior bugs from being
inadvertently introduced[3] to the codebase from now on. So, replace
the one-element array with a flexible-array member.

Also, make use of the new struct_size() helper to properly calculate the
size of struct smu10_voltage_dependency_table.

This issue was found with the help of Coccinelle and, audited and fixed
_manually_.
